1 million recipes for sangria are all over the web. I made a sangria for a recent wine walk event in West Reading and did not have too much time in advance to macerate the fruit so cheating was required.
I grabbed in season fruit to make this sangria…
- 1 cantaloupe, cubed
- 2 handfuls of strawberries, hulled
- 2 peaches, sliced
- 1 apple, sliced
- mixed with
- 2 liters of white wine
- splash of agave
- dirty secret ingredient…below
What I forgot to add was the mint or basil.
To speed the flavor process along ..my dirty secret… was grabbing a bottle of peach cream manischewitz wine. Yup, that is what I did. With so many flavored liqueurs out there why not use a little something extra when mixing up your own brew of sangria?
